Complete Guide To Plasterboard Skip Hire

Plasterboard waste cannot be disposed of with general or mixed waste due to the way gypsum reacts when sent to landfill. Hiring a dedicated plasterboard skip ensures your waste is handled safely and in line with regulations.

Ideal for refurbishment and fit-out projects

Plasterboard skips are commonly used for:

  • Home renovations and refurbishments
  • Office and commercial fit-outs
  • Drylining and partitioning work
  • Ceiling replacements
  • New build and extension projects

Keeping plasterboard separate helps reduce disposal costs and avoids contamination charges.

Placement and permits

Plasterboard skips can usually be placed on private land such as a driveway. If the skip needs to be positioned on a public road or pavement, a permit may be required. If you are unsure, contact our team on 0800 066 5550 for advice.
